At the Yunqi Summit held in China Hangzhou, Wu Yongming, CEO of Alibaba Group and Chairman of Alibaba Cloud Intelligence Group, delivered a significant speech. He clearly stated that achieving Artificial General Intelligence (AGI) is no longer a hypothesis but an inevitable trend. However, this is merely the starting point; the ultimate goal is to develop Artificial Superintelligence (ASI) capable of self-iteration and comprehensively surpassing human intelligence. For the first time, Wu Yongming elaborated in detail on the three major evolutionary phases towards ASI.
The first phase is “Intelligent Emergence,” where AI, through learning vast amounts of human knowledge, acquires generalized intelligent capabilities. The second phase is “Autonomous Action,” where AI masters the use of tools and programming capabilities, beginning to assist humans in completing complex tasks. This is the stage where the industry currently resides. The third phase is “Self-Iteration,” where AI, by connecting with the physical world and achieving self-learning, ultimately surpasses human intelligence.
To achieve this goal, Alibaba Cloud has defined a clear strategic path. As a “full-stack artificial intelligence service provider,” Alibaba Cloud will advance its AI strategy through two core pathways. First, Tongyi Qianwen will adhere to the open-source and open route, committed to building the “Android of the AI era.” Second, Alibaba Cloud will construct a super AI cloud as the “next-generation computer,” providing a global intelligent computing power network.
Wu Yongming revealed that Alibaba is actively promoting a three-year plan for AI infrastructure construction with a total investment of 380 billion RMB and plans to continuously increase investments. The latest news is that this large-scale investment marks one of the most ambitious AI infrastructure initiatives in China, signaling Alibaba Cloud’s determination to prepare for the ASI era. According to long-term planning, by 2032, the energy consumption scale of Alibaba Cloud’s global data centers will be ten times that of 2022, preparing for the arrival of the ASI era. The world is currently undergoing an intelligence revolution driven by artificial intelligence. Over the past few hundred years, the industrial revolution amplified human physical capabilities through mechanization, and the information revolution amplified human information processing capabilities through digitization. This time, the intelligence revolution will far exceed imagination. AGI will not only amplify human intelligence but also liberate human potential, paving the way for the advent of ASI. In recent years, AI’s intellectual level has rapidly increased, jumping from a high school level to a doctoral level, even winning gold medals in the International Mathematical Olympiad. AI chatbots have become the fastest function to penetrate the user base in human history, with industry penetration rates surpassing all previous technologies. The total global investment in the AI industry has exceeded $400 billion, and cumulative investment over the next five years will exceed $4 trillion, which will accelerate the birth of more powerful models and promote the widespread penetration of AI applications.
Wu Yongming believes that the goal of AGI is to liberate humans from 80% of daily work, allowing people to focus on creation and exploration. ASI, as a system that comprehensively surpasses human intelligence, may create a group of “super scientists” and “full-stack super engineers” capable of solving scientific and engineering challenges at an unimaginable speed, such as conquering medical problems, inventing new materials, solving sustainable energy and climate issues, and even achieving interstellar travel.
The path to ASI will go through three stages. The first stage is “Intelligent Emergence,” where AI acquires generalized intelligent capabilities by understanding the world’s collection of knowledge. The second stage is “Autonomous Action,” where AI gains the ability to act in the real world, capable of decomposing complex tasks, using and creating tools, and autonomously completing interactions with both the digital and physical worlds. The third stage is “Self-Iteration,” where AI, by connecting with the physical world and achieving self-learning, ultimately surpasses human intelligence.

In the “Autonomous Action” stage, key AI capabilities include Tool Use and Coding. Through Tool Use, AI can call external software, interfaces, and physical devices like a human to execute complex real-world tasks. The improvement of Coding capabilities helps AI solve more complex problems and digitize more scenarios. In the future, natural language will become the source code of the AI era; anyone will be able to create their own Agent using natural language to accomplish almost all tasks in the digital world. In the “Self-Iteration” stage, AI needs to obtain more comprehensive and raw data directly from the physical world. Currently, the areas where AI is advancing fastest are content creation, mathematics, and Coding – areas where knowledge is 100% defined and created by humans. However, for the broader physical world, what AI encounters is mostly knowledge summarized by humans, lacking extensive, raw data from interacting with the physical world. Therefore, for AI to achieve breakthroughs surpassing humans, it needs to acquire data directly from the physical world.
As AI penetrates more physical world scenarios and understands more physical world data, AI models and Agent capabilities will become increasingly powerful, having the opportunity to build training infrastructure, optimize data processes, and upgrade model architectures for their own model upgrades and iterations, thereby achieving Self-learning. Future models will, through continuous interaction with the real world, acquire new data and receive real-time feedback, leveraging reinforcement learning and continuous learning mechanisms to autonomously optimize, correct biases, and achieve self-iteration and intelligent upgrades.
Wu Yongming also made two important judgments. First, large models are the next generation’s operating system, replacing the current status of OSs and becoming the tool interface linking the real world. In the future, almost all user needs and industry applications will execute tasks through tools related to large models; LLMs will become the OS of the AI era. Second, the ASI cloud is the next generation’s computer, meeting anyone’s needs and carrying massive computational resources.
Based on these judgments, Alibaba Cloud has made strategic choices: Tongyi Qianwen chooses the open route to build the Android of the AI era. Alibaba Cloud believes that in the LLM era, the value created and the scenarios penetrated by open-source models will far exceed those of closed-source models. Simultaneously, Alibaba Cloud operates China’s leading and globally top-tier AI infrastructure and cloud computing network, being one of the few super AI cloud computing platforms globally capable of vertical integration of software and hardware. Alibaba Cloud is fully committed to building a new AI supercomputer that possesses both the most advanced AI infrastructure and the most advanced models, enabling collaborative innovation in basic architecture design and model architecture, thus ensuring the highest efficiency when calling and training large models on Alibaba Cloud. To meet the industry’s long-term demand for AI infrastructure, Alibaba Cloud is actively promoting the three-year 380 billion RMB AI infrastructure construction plan and plans to continuously increase investment.
